Mayor Quill Proclaims May 15 - 21, 2022 as National EMS Week

WHEREAS, emergency medical services is a vital public service and the members of emergency medical services teams are ready to provide lifesaving care to those in need 24 hours a day, seven days a week; and

WHEREAS, access to quality emergency care dramatically improves the survival and recovery rate of those who experience sudden illness or injury; and

WHEREAS, emergency medical services has grown to fill a gap by providing important, out of hospital care, including preventative medicine, follow-up care, and access to telemedicine; and

WHEREAS, the emergency medical services system consists of first responders, emergency medical technicians, paramedics, emergency medical dispatchers, firefighters, police officers, educators, administrators, pre-hospital nurses, emergency nurses, emergency physicians, trained members of the public, and other out of hospital medical care providers; and

WHEREAS, the members of emergency medical services teams engage in thousands of hours of specialized training and continuing education to enhance their lifesaving skills; and

WHEREAS, the Emergency Medical Services (EMS) Week theme for 2022 is Rising to the Challenge and it is an appropriate theme to recognize the value and the accomplishments of the integration of the new Auburn City Ambulance into our City of Auburn organization over the past 12 months; andNational EMS Week in Auburn, NY is May 15 - 21, 2022

WHEREAS, the establishment of the new Auburn City Ambulance department was an initiative that took significant planning and  implementation by several individuals within our City of Auburn staff and upon the transition to the new Auburn City Ambulance in November of 2022 the City has been diligently served by our City Manager, City Comptroller, Fire Chief, ACA Director of Operations, the 25 full and part time City EMS team members and others providing administrative support, and these cumulative efforts that have successfully delivered outstanding ambulance operations to the citizens of our City and the greater Auburn area.

NOW THEREFORE, I, Michael D. Quill Mayor of the City of Auburn along with members of the City Council and the citizens of Auburn, in recognition of the service of our new Auburn City Ambulance department do hereby proclaim the week of May 15-21, 2022, as

EMERGENCY MEDICAL SERVICES WEEK

in the City of Auburn and we recognize with our sincerest gratitude all within our organization for Rising to the Challenge to ensure that effective and efficient emergency medical service response is a component of our City’s overall public safety response efforts to our community, and furthermore, we thank the men and women who have joined our organization and serve our community daily on the front line of service as Paramedics and Emergency Service Technicians in our new Auburn City Ambulance Department.

In witness whereof I have hereunto set my hand and caused the seal of the City of Auburn to be affixed this twelfth day of May 2022.
